Description

The mission of the Learning Disabilities Association of Pennsylvania (LDA of PA) is to promote and support the education and general welfare of individuals with learning and attention issues and their families. We do this by running multisensory reading and math instruction workshops to help teachers learn how to more effectively educate students with learning disabilities. We run a reading instruction tutoring program for low income and underserved students. We produce multisensory videos of complex scientific protocols from high school and college science classes to help students that think differently learn laboratory science more efficiently. We use improv comedy as a way of teaching children with learning disabilities how to increase their confidence. We run trainings for colleges and businesses to help them increase accessibility to people with learning disabilities. We also respond to hundreds of adults and parents seeking help finding appropriate learning disability-focused services in their area.
